MyMarketPulse (mymarketpulse.com) just released its analysis of the March 2024 market data for McDowell County, North Carolina.
As of 3/2024, McDowell County had a Median Sale Price of $320,500, which was up 3.9% from the previous month and up 39.7% from the prior year.
29 homes were sold, a decrease 19.4% from the previous month and a decrease of 23.7% from the prior year.
The median time homes spent on the market was 111 day, which is up 11 day compared to last month and an increase of 34 days over the previous year.
With a Market Pulse Score of 100, the analysis suggests a flat trend in McDowell County’s housing market momentum.
